Thanks guys! It's pretty rough I'd like to restore why would I or wouldn't I? Opinions welcome! Thanks again!
 
It’s not as rough as you think. You can search for some before and after here and you will be surprised what a good detailing will do. To restore this bike will likely cost you more than it’s worth. Chrome alone will be $600 or better and no telling what a set of decals will cost-they will have to be custom made. Unless there is a lot of sentimental attachment here there is no upside to a restoration.
 
Cool bike! Yes as others said, your bike will clean up nicely. It will look much different after a good clean up of the paint and chrome. Original paint bikes generally hold more value to most collectors.
